Eastman Museum

The Eastman Museum, officially known as the George Eastman Museum, is located in Rochester, New York. It is dedicated to the history of photography and film and houses a vast collection of photographs, cameras, and motion picture artifacts. Founded by George Eastman, the inventor of roll film and founder of Kodak, the museum also features a stunning mansion that belonged to Eastman. Besides its exhibitions, the museum offers educational programs and hosts film screenings, making it a cultural hub for those interested in the art and science of photography and cinema.
